摘要
无线传感器网络的路由将高能效放在首位,设计分级簇作为路由基础是一种能有效节能,延长网络寿命的好方法。在基于能量的分级簇(EAHC)算法的基础上,按照簇头级数和能量排队,从叶子节点开始逐级进行优化,提出一种减少簇头和降低簇树级数的优化算法(EAHC-O),能进一步地延长全网寿命,并通过仿真验证算法的有效性。
Energy-efficient routing design is important requirement in wireless sensor network. Designing a high-efficient cluster tree backbone network for the basic of routing is an effective way for prolonging network lifetime. Based on the EAHC (Energy-Aware Hierarchical Clustering)algorithm, we propose EAHCO, the optimization method. This optimization algorithm reduces the level of the cluster tree and the number of cluster heads, thereby reducing the unnecessary energy dissipation in data transmitting, achieving the purpose of optimization. The simulation results demonstrate that the optimization algorithm can improve the network lifetime effectively.
